Mahogany Drop-Leaf Pembroke Table

Mahogany Drop-Leaf Pembroke Table

A Pembroke table with two drop leaves, a central drawer and finely turned legs. Closed it sits neatly against a wall; open it gives a generous occasional or dining surface. The Pembroke is the most quietly useful table ever designed, and it has been solving small rooms for two hundred years.

Period
Late Georgian / Early Victorian, c. 1820-1850
Material
Mahogany and mahogany veneer; metal hardware
Kind
Drop-Leaf Tables
H72 W90 D50cm
